What Is Prompt Engineering?
Prompt engineering is the art and science of crafting inputs that guide AI models to produce the most relevant, accurate, and useful outputs. It's not just about asking questions—it's about providing context, setting parameters, and structuring requests in ways that maximize the AI's understanding and response quality.
Think of it as the difference between asking a stranger for directions by saying "Where's the restaurant?" versus "I'm looking for the Italian restaurant called Mario's on 5th Street, near the blue building with the coffee shop on the corner." The second approach provides context, specificity, and clear intent.
Why Context Is Everything in AI Conversations
The Problem with Generic Prompts
When you ask an AI model a generic question like "Write a marketing email," you're leaving too much to interpretation. The AI doesn't know:
- Your brand voice and tone
- Your target audience
- The specific product or service
- Your company's values and messaging
- The email's purpose and call-to-action
The result? Generic, often irrelevant responses that require extensive revision or complete rewrites.
The Power of Rich Context
Now consider this enhanced prompt:
Write a marketing email for our B2B SaaS project management tool. Brand voice: Professional but approachable, focusing on productivity and efficiency. Audience: Mid-level managers at tech companies, ages 28-45, struggling with team coordination. Product: CloudFlow - helps teams visualize project timelines and automate status updates. Goal: Announce our new integration with Slack and drive trial signups. Tone: Excited but not overly salesy, emphasizing practical benefits. Length: 200-250 words with a clear CTA.
This context-rich prompt will generate a significantly more relevant, targeted, and useful response. But here's the challenge: most people don't have the time or energy to recreate this level of detail for every AI interaction.

Common Prompt Engineering Mistakes
1. Being Too Vague
Bad: "Help me with my presentation" Better: "Create an outline for a 20-minute presentation about cybersecurity best practices for a non-technical executive audience"
2. Providing No Context
Bad: "Write code for user authentication" Better: "Write a React component for user authentication using Firebase Auth, with email/password login, error handling, and redirect to dashboard on success"
3. Inconsistent Formatting
Different prompt structures for similar tasks lead to inconsistent results and make it harder to build on previous work.
4. Not Leveraging System Messages
Many users ignore the power of system messages and role-setting to establish consistent behavior patterns.

Best Practices for Effective Prompt Engineering
1. Start with Role Definition
Begin prompts by establishing the AI's role and expertise level:
"You are a senior UX designer with 10 years of experience in e-commerce platforms..."
2. Provide Rich Context
Include all relevant background information:
- Project goals and constraints
- Target audience characteristics
- Brand guidelines and tone
- Technical requirements
- Success criteria
3. Use Structured Formatting
Organize complex prompts with clear sections:
Context: [Background information] Task: [Specific request] Requirements: [Detailed specifications] Output Format: [Expected structure] Examples: [Reference samples]
4. Iterate and Refine
Track which prompts work best and continuously refine them based on results.
5. Version Control Your Prompts
Keep track of prompt evolution and performance across different versions.
